Linguistics and the Eurovision Song Contest 7.5 credits

About the course

The course addresses linguistic perspectives on the Eurovision Song Contest. Using the Eurovision Song Contest as a starting point, the course provides an introduction to European language policy, discourse analysis, multilingualism and metaphors.

The course consists of five modules:

  1. introduction to the Eurovision Song Contest from a linguistic perspective (1.5 credits)
  2. discursive perspectives on gender, political identity, and nationality (1.5 credits)
  3. multilingualism (1,5hp)
  4. metaphors (1.5 credits)
  5. individual specialisation (1,5hp)
